    Echo anyone here who has used them in Australia. Bream are very similar to sheepshead IE love structure etc these crankas outfish other crab immitations heavily, largely due to the action of the floating claws. Particularly when the fish are picking at the claws. Just cast tight to features and gently work or leave it static. They seem to target bigger bream too. All the comp guys are fishing these heavily here

    This lure absolutely slays fish, there are plenty of how to use videos of anglers in Australia (where the lure is from) catching bream, very similar to sheep’s head. If you learn to use it, they work really well, & because the trebles float upside down they’re actually pretty snag resistant.. as far as the price goes, they’re no more expensive than any Japan made lure.
